一.说明 前文介绍了基于安卓客户端的开发,在此基础上,进行少许改动即可开发出一款基于TCP的安卓服务器,理论知识请参见笔者上一篇博文,下面直接实践操作。 二.权限申明 三.布局文件 四.具体实现代码 五.Debug 六.实际运行效果 ...
分类:
移动开发 时间:
2017-05-12 13:16:27
阅读次数:
253
Activity常用方法 setContentView(R.layout.xxxx);//设置布局文件 getViewById(R.id.xxxx);//获取指定控件 getString(R.String.xxxx);//获取Strings XML指定key的值注意:可以用Java代码生成界面,也可 ...
分类:
其他好文 时间:
2017-05-11 17:09:40
阅读次数:
183
版权声明:本文为博主原创文章,未经博主允许不得转载。 前言 基于系统Toast的自定义显示风格的Toast。 效果图 代码分析 ToastCustom类基于系统Toast,不是继承Toast,只是通过toast.setView(view)方法引用自定义的显示风格布局文件,达到自定义显示风格的目的。 ...
分类:
其他好文 时间:
2017-05-10 21:17:41
阅读次数:
333
一.概念 Activity相当于浏览器的标签,相当于空白的网页; Activity可以跳转,就相当于浏览器内点击链接后跳转到另外一个浏览器窗口 二.怎样创建Activity setContentView(R.layout.main);//设置布局文件 ...
分类:
移动开发 时间:
2017-05-10 00:19:01
阅读次数:
209
布局文件创建Item创建数据准备适配器绑定和监听器1.布局文件 2.item 3.适配器和监听 ...
分类:
移动开发 时间:
2017-05-08 23:12:18
阅读次数:
152
自定义控件中除了绘制流程涉及到的测量布局绘制的api, 还有一些api使用的也比较频繁,这里叔做了一下总结,也请同学们补充或纠正,让叔也涨涨姿势。 inflate inflate方法常常用来解析一个xml布局文件,在自定义组合式控件中常常使用,使用的姿势包括: 而View.inflate其实还是调用 ...
分类:
其他好文 时间:
2017-05-08 19:56:51
阅读次数:
176
1. 在res目录下的drawable目录下新建shape.xml文件 2.在布局文件中调用。 ...
分类:
移动开发 时间:
2017-05-07 21:14:59
阅读次数:
225
一、样式布局 首先,先看下面这段样式布局代码,这里称在xml控件上添加属性为内联(仅限于本篇博文这样称呼): 在上面这段XML布局代码,可以看出,各个按钮的样式完全一样,添加某个属性给控件就有多次。假如,有更多的控件使用相同的而已,要做N次重复的工作。Android提供了各种样式UI,可用于解决重复 ...
分类:
移动开发 时间:
2017-05-07 15:46:39
阅读次数:
261
一、布局文件 设置界面,添加一个ImageView,和两个Button按钮,设置其属性及id 二、声明网络权限 因为使用网络功能需要添加权限,修改AndroidManifest.xml文件添加权限声明语句。 三、编辑ManActivity.java文件。 四、运行结果 点击下载按钮下载图片。读取图片 ...
分类:
移动开发 时间:
2017-05-07 14:55:09
阅读次数:
280
前端应用程序 ASP.NET Zero包含可以作为您的公共网站或应用程序着陆页的起点的前端页面。首次运行项目时,您会看到主页如下所示: 这里有两页:主页和关于。这些页面的内容只是占位符和演示目的。您可以根据需要完全删除内容并构建页面。此外,你应该改变的标志与贵公司的标志。 请参阅 metronic前 ...
分类:
Web程序 时间:
2017-05-07 14:47:29
阅读次数:
241